Code of Ethics
Tarotskill.com requires all members, including holders of a Tarot Readerscore and the Certified Tarot Master (CTM) to follow a strict code of ethics as follows:

- Tarot Readers shall read cards accurately, based on the reader’s intuition, regardless of the impact on payment.
- Tarot Readers will not attempt to engage in services outside the scope of practice, including offering medical, mental health, legal or other advice, unless they are appropriately licensed medical or legal professionals.
- Tarot Readers shall not discriminate in the delivery of their services or the conduct of professional activities based on race, ethnicity, sex, gender identity/gender expression, sexual orientation, age, religion, national origin, disability, culture, language, or dialect.
- Tarot Readers shall protect clients’ confidentiality and not discuss details of a reading outside the client’s presence.
- Tarot Readers whose professional work is adversely affected by substance abuse, addiction, or other health-related conditions are impaired practitioners and shall seek professional assistance and, where appropriate, withdraw from their work.
- Tarot Readers shall enhance and refine their professional competence and expertise through engagement in lifelong learning applicable to their professional activities and skills.
- Tarot Readers shall not misrepresent their credentials, competence, education, training, experience, and spiritual contributions.
- Tarot Readers shall avoid engaging in conflicts of interest whereby personal, financial, or other considerations have the potential to influence or compromise professional judgment and objectivity.
- Tarot Readers shall not defraud through intent, ignorance, or negligence or engage in any scheme to defraud in connection with obtaining payment, reimbursement, or grants and contracts for services provided
- Tarot Readers shall not engage in any form of conduct that adversely reflects on the tarot reading profession.
- Tarot Readers shall not engage in dishonesty, negligence, fraud, deceit, or misrepresentation.
- Tarot Readers shall not engage in any form of harassment, power abuse, or sexual harassment.
- Tarot Readers shall not knowingly allow anyone under their supervision to engage in any practice that violates this Code of Ethics.
- Tarot Readers shall reference the source when using other persons’ ideas, research, presentations, results, or products in written, oral, or any other media presentation or summary. To do otherwise constitutes plagiarism.
- Tarot Readers shall not discriminate in their relationships with colleagues, assistants, students, support personnel, and members of other professions and disciplines based on race, ethnicity, sex, gender identity/gender expression, sexual orientation, age, religion, national origin, disability, culture, language, dialect, or socioeconomic status.
- Tarot Readers making and responding to complaints shall comply fully with the policies of CompetentSee, LLC in its consideration, adjudication, and resolution of complaints of alleged violations of the Code of Ethics.
- Tarot Readers involved in ethics complaints shall not knowingly make false statements of fact or withhold relevant facts necessary to adjudicate the complaints fairly.
- Tarot Readers shall comply with local, state, and federal laws and regulations applicable to tarot reading.
- Tarot Readers who have been convicted; been found guilty; or entered a plea of guilty or nolo contendere to (1) any misdemeanor involving dishonesty, physical harm—or the threat of physical harm—to the person or property of another, or (2) any felony, shall self-report by notifying to CompetentSee, LLC in writing within 30 days of the conviction, plea, or finding of guilt. Tarot Readers shall also provide a certified copy of the conviction, plea, nolo contendere.
